Cost of Attendance Tables
Mennonite College of Nursing students who first enrolled in Fall 2025, Spring 2026, or Summer 2026
The tables below illustrate the estimated cost of attendance for the 2025-2026 academic year (August-May) for an undergraduate student enrolled for 15 hours for the fall and spring semesters.
Mennonite College of Nursing
-
On-campus, Illinois resident
Tuition$13,876
Fees$4,078
Food and Housing$12,382
Direct/Billable Costs$30,336
Books and Supplies$830
Transportation$2,452
Personal Expenses$3,422
Indirect Costs$6,704
Total Estimated Costs$37,040

Key Terms
-
Tuition & Fees
Tuition and fee amounts listed are estimates based on 15 credit hours (undergraduate) or 9 hours (graduate).
-
Food & Housing
Food and Housing for off-campus students is paid by the student directly to the landlord/property manager/family member. The amounts listed are estimates and reflect average costs; individual experience will vary.
On-campus amounts are based on average cost for housing and the unlimited meal plan.
-
Books & Supplies, Transportation, and Personal Expenses
These costs are not paid to the University, but to the seller or provider of the service.
